Identify The Leak And Immediate Actions

First, determine whether the liquid is water or a different substance. Water around the indoor coil usually means condensate drainage is blocked or overflowing. A refrigerant-like odor or oily residue may indicate a refrigerant issue, which requires urgent professional attention. If you notice pooling near the furnace or air handler, shut off power to the AC at the breaker to prevent electrical hazards and damage to components.

    Immediate steps

  • Turn off the thermostat and the main power to the AC at the electrical panel.
  • Inspect visible condensate lines and the drain pan for clogs or overflow.
  • If accessible, check the drain line for kinks, blockages, or wet spots along the line.
  • Clean away any standing water near the air handler to reduce mold risk.

Shutoff Power And Safety Considerations

Working with an active AC circuit can pose electrical shock risks. Ensure the thermostat is in the off position and switch off the dedicated circuit breaker for the outdoor condensing unit as well as the indoor air handler if accessible. Do not run the unit if you suspect a refrigerant leak or damaged electrical components. Refrigerant leaks are hazardous and require licensed technicians under federal and state regulations.

Common Causes Of Leaks

Recognizing the root cause helps determine the right fix. Common reasons for AC leaks include condensate line clogs, a full or damaged condensate drain pan, improper installation, or frozen coils that thaw into water runoff. In some cases, high humidity, blocked vents, or a malfunctioning condensate pump can also lead to leaks. Refrigerant leaks, though rarer, indicate a more serious problem and demand prompt professional intervention.

DIY Troubleshooting You Can Do

Simple checks can save time and money before calling a pro. Start with these non-invasive steps:

  • Clear visible condensate lines using a wet/dry vacuum or pipe brush if you can access the drain line safely.
  • Ensure the outdoor unit has proper clearance for airflow and that the condensate line runs downhill to the exterior. Remove debris near the unit.
  • Check the condensate drain pan under the indoor coil; if cracked or overflowing, a replacement is needed.
  • Check for ice on the refrigerant line; a frozen coil usually means low refrigerant, dirty air filter, or restricted airflow.

Safety note: Do not attempt refrigerant service yourself. Refrigerant handling requires licensing in the United States, and improper handling can be illegal and dangerous.

When To Call A Professional

Contact a licensed HVAC technician if any of the following apply: persistent leaks after clearing the drain, ice on the refrigerant lines, strong chemical or refrigerant odor, water damage spreading beyond the expected drain area, or the unit failing to cool effectively after basic fixes. A pro can diagnose refrigerant leaks, replace damaged components, inspect electrical connections, and ensure the system is charged and calibrated correctly. Timely service can prevent further damage and maintain efficiency.

Preventive Maintenance To Stop Leaks

Preventive measures reduce the likelihood of leaks and extend equipment life. Key practices include:

  • Regular filter changes to maintain airflow and reduce coil freezing risk.
  • Annual professional inspection of condensate lines, drain pans, and pumps.
  • Ensure proper installation with correct slope on drain lines to prevent standing water.
  • Keep the outdoor unit clear of debris and ensure adequate airflow around the condenser.
  • Install a secondary condensate drain or overflow switch if the system is in a high-risk area for water damage.

Quick Reference: What Not To Do

Avoid using chemical cleaners in drain lines without guidance, attempting to seal refrigerant leaks, or running the unit when water is present around electrical components. Do not ignore signs of mold growth or persistent dampness, as these can affect indoor air quality and health.
